u/Pm-ur-butt 12d ago
To get a star, there is an $85,000 sponsorship fee which covers the initial installation as well as the lifetime cleaning and repair of the star.
Fun Fact: the fee for the stars are typically paid for by production companies, film studios, record labels or even fan clubs. Donald Trump is one of the few and maybe even the only person to have paid their own sponsorship fee.
EDIT: today its $85k. It continues to rise, 10 years ago it was $30k. Not sure how much Dumbold Trump paid

u/minnick27 12d ago
And even then, it’s a bit of a gamble. I was part of a group of fans that raised money to get weird Al his star. We raised the money for it pretty quickly and submitted the application. The application had the full endorsement of Al and his management and it also had two celebrities that were willing to speak at the ceremony. We will turn down for 14 years before the application was finally accepted. In that time frame, they raised the price three times. Every time they raised it, we immediately went on a fundraising binge and got the money within months. One member of the Hollywood Chamber of Commerce commented that it broke her heart seeing his application come across her desk year after year, knowing it was going to be denied. When it was finally awarded to him in 2018, they actually made a separate viewing section just for the donors because we had waited so long and put so much effort into it. And during his speech Al begged people not to pickaxe his star

u/-Nicolai 12d ago
It ignites sand, asbestos, glass, and even ashes of substances that have already burned in oxygen. In one particular industrial accident, a spill of 900 kg of ClF3 burned through 30 cm of concrete and 90 cm of gravel beneath. There is exactly one known fire control/suppression method capable of dealing with ClF3—flooding the fire with nitrogen or noble gases such as argon. Barring that, the area must simply be kept cool until the reaction ceases. The compound reacts with water-based suppressors and CO2, rendering them counterproductive.

u/Raffix 12d ago
TIL that no star on the Hollywood walk of fame has ever been removed, except for James Stewart and Kirk Douglas in 2000 after a theft, but were eventually recovered and restored.
There has been a lot of backlash to remove the stars of Bill Cosby and Donald Trump, but both are still there.
